About Immigration Consultant
An Immigration Consultant helps individuals and businesses prepare and manage immigration- and visa-related applications. Depending on the destination country, the work may include eligibility assessments, document checklists, form preparation, appointment scheduling guidance, and case tracking. Some cases also involve coordination with licensed lawyers where legal representation is required.
You may need an Immigration Consultant when you are dealing with strict timelines (school intakes, job start dates), complex personal histories (prior refusals, name changes), family relationship documentation, or when the destination country has point-based systems or investment/entrepreneur pathways.
Average cost in Hechi: Not publicly stated. In practice, pricing varies widely based on destination country, urgency, and whether you need translations, notarization support, or legal representation. Many providers charge either a consultation fee or a bundled package fee.
Licensing / certifications: This depends heavily on the destination country and the exact services. In many jurisdictions, only authorized representatives can provide immigration advice or represent you. For example, some countries require licensed immigration advisers or qualified lawyers. If a consultant claims they can “guarantee approval” or refuses to show authorization, treat it as a red flag.

Cost of Hiring a Immigration Consultant in Hechi
Average price range: Not publicly stated. In real-world engagements, costs often vary / depend on (1) destination country, (2) case complexity, and (3) whether the provider is offering basic document preparation versus end-to-end management.
Emergency pricing: Not publicly stated. Some providers charge expedited service fees when timelines are tight (e.g., upcoming intake deadlines or urgent travel), especially if additional staff time or rapid document handling is required.
What affects cost: Expect pricing to change based on how much hands-on work is included and whether third-party fees are involved.
Common cost factors include:
- Destination country and visa/immigration category (study, work, family, investment)
- Prior refusals, overstays, or complex personal history
- Number of applicants (single vs. family applications)
- Translation, notarization, and document legalization needs
- Speed/urgency and appointment availability
- Whether legal representation by a qualified lawyer is required (varies by jurisdiction)
Tip for Hechi clients: ask for a written scope (what’s included/excluded), a timeline estimate, and a list of third-party government fees you must pay directly.

Can an Immigration Consultant guarantee visa approval?
No provider can honestly guarantee approval because final decisions are made by the destination country’s authorities. Be cautious of anyone promising “100% approval” or pressuring you into quick deposits.
What documents should I prepare before contacting a consultant in Hechi?
Usually: passport, ID, household registration (if relevant), education/work records, bank statements (if required), travel history, and any prior refusal letters. Exact requirements vary / depend on destination and category.
Should I use a consultant or apply myself?
If your case is straightforward and you’re comfortable following official instructions, self-application may be fine. Use a consultant when timelines are tight, documents are complex, or you’ve had a prior refusal.
How long does immigration processing take from Hechi?
Varies / depends on destination country, visa type, and appointment availability. A consultant should provide a timeline estimate and highlight what parts you can control (document readiness, translations).
What should be included in an Immigration Consultant contract?
Clear scope of work, fees and refund terms, who pays government fees, expected timelines, responsibilities (your vs. consultant), and how updates are communicated.
How do I verify a consultant is legitimate for my destination country?
Ask for the consultant’s authorization details (where applicable), check the official regulator for that country, and confirm the contract identifies the legal entity providing services.
